Endgame Positions to Know Before Your Reach 2000

Level

Beginner, Intermediate, Advanced


Recommended Rating

0-2000


Topic Purpose

The thing I hate most in chess is to lose games that I was winning! The endgames series teaches how to win endings that you’re supposed to win. It teaches how to draw endings that you’re supposed to draw. And it might teach how not to lose endings that you’re supposed to lose.
